STIGLER PANTHERS
Coach: Tyler Guthrie
OUTLOOK
The Stigler boys golf team heads into the upcoming season with a young lineup, but one that features a proven competitor at the top and a promising newcomer ready to make an immediate impact. Head coach Tyler Guthrie knows his squad will rely heavily on leadership and development as the year unfolds.
“We have one returner in Colt Falconer who made the 4A State Tournament last year as an individual,” Guthrie said. “We will be very inexperienced; however, we have an incoming freshmen Carter Shepherd that will be a huge help.”
Falconer’s experience at the state level provides Stigler with a steady presence and a high ceiling as the team looks to grow.
“Colt is extremely talented and hits the ball a mile,” Guthrie said. “He is very dedicated to his craft and is ready to make a jump this year to compete for a state championship.”
Falconer’s background in the sport has helped shape his approach and mindset on the course, and his pedigree reflects the tradition Stigler golf has built over the years.
“He is the son of a former 3A State Champion Todd Falconer,” Guthrie said.
Joining Falconer is freshman Carter Shepherd, who steps into varsity competition with strong family ties to the program and a reputation for putting in the work.
“Carter is a talented freshman who really puts in the time,” Guthrie said. “His dad was also a former state championship, and his grandpa was the golf coach here at Stigler for several years.”
Shepherd’s work ethic and familiarity with the program have made his transition an exciting one for the Panthers as they prepare for the spring season.
“He has a good pedigree, and we are looking forward to seeing him compete this spring,” Guthrie said.
With Falconer returning from a state appearance and Shepherd emerging as a key underclassman, Stigler’s boys golf team is focused on gaining experience and building toward future success. Though young, the Panthers are anchored by talent, dedication, and a strong connection to the program’s past — setting the stage for growth throughout the season.
